Charleston entrepreneur Carrie Morey reflects on the expansion of Callie’s Hot Little Biscuit and renovation of her Old Village home, where business, family, and hospitality inform her authentic approach to life.

More than a decade after first appearing on the cover of Charleston Home + Design Magazine, Carrie Morey returns at a pivotal moment in her career. When she was first featured, Callie’s Biscuits was beginning to gain national traction.

Today, the company has expanded its reach, product lines, and retail presence, growing into one of Charleston’s most recognizable entrepreneurial success stories. At the same time, Carrie has completed a thoughtful renovation of her historic Church Street home, creating a space that reflects her priorities: authenticity, functionality, and the people who gather around her table.

Carrie Morey’s family home is a residence designed for daily use, frequent hosting, and the realities of balancing a growing business with family life. Here, the connection between her personal and professional worlds becomes clear. The house functions as a place to gather, cook, work, and unwind, reflecting the same values that built her company from the ground up.

Balancing motherhood and business has never been about perfection for Carrie. From the beginning, she structured Callie’s around her children’s schedules, not the other way around. School drop-offs, after-school activities, and family dinners remained nonnegotiable, even as wholesale accounts expanded and production demands increased. She built the company in phases, resisting rapid growth when it threatened to compromise quality or presence at home.
